Parallel Kingdom MMORPG helping to feed the hungry this Thanksgiving

Well this is some gaming news on a different level. PerBlue, the developers of the location-based MMORPG for mobile called Parallel Kingdom, is allowing players to buy two special hats using food from in-game which will then be used to buy actual meals for those families in need this Thanksgiving.

When you buy one of the to hats using in-game food, PerBlue will turn that into donations to HELP USA which helps kids and families who need help to have a Thanksgiving meal this year. The Food Hats, which are happens to be an item your character can use in game, can be purchased with in-game food. PerBlue will take that purchase and convert it into a donation for HELP USA.

There are two limited edition hats you will be able to buy: a red Food Basket Hat which can be purchased for 750 food and a golden Food Basket Hat which is available for 6,000 food. Buying a red hat will provide a meal on Thanksgiving for one homeless child while the golden hat will supply a meal for an entire family. It's a brilliant idea and if you happen to be one of the 800,000 players in Parallel Kingdom, this is definitely something to consider doing between now and Thanksgiving.
